Water pooling prevention services focus on addressing areas where excess water collects on a property’s surface, especially after rainfall or irrigation. These services typically involve assessing the property’s landscape, grading, and drainage systems to identify zones prone to water accumulation. Professionals may recommend modifications such as regrading the terrain to promote proper runoff, installing drainage solutions like French drains or surface grates, or adjusting existing landscape features to prevent water from pooling in undesirable locations. The goal is to create a landscape that efficiently directs water away from foundations, walkways, and other critical areas, reducing the risk of water-related issues.

Pooling water can lead to various problems for property owners. Excess water accumulation can cause soil erosion, damage to landscaping, and create muddy or slippery surfaces that pose safety hazards. Over time, standing water near foundations or basements may contribute to structural issues, including cracks or water intrusion. Additionally, persistent pooling can promote the growth of mold, mildew, and pests, which can impact the health and safety of occupants. By preventing water pooling, property owners can maintain a safer, more stable environment while protecting their investment from water-related damages.

Inspection and Assessment Costs - Typically, evaluating water pooling issues can range from $150 to $400, depending on the property size and complexity. An example might be a thorough drainage assessment for a residential yard in Salisbury, MD. These costs cover identifying problem areas and recommending solutions.

Drainage System Installation - Installing new drainage solutions generally costs between $2,000 and $7,000. For instance, installing French drains or surface grading in a suburban property might fall within this range. Prices vary based on the scope and materials used.

Surface Grading and Re-sloping - Regrading or re-sloping a yard to prevent pooling typically costs $1,500 to $5,000. An example would be reshaping a backyard to improve runoff, with costs influenced by yard size and soil conditions. This service helps redirect water away from problem areas.

Maintenance and Preventative Services - Ongoing maintenance, such as clearing drains or minor grading, usually ranges from $100 to $300 per visit. For a residential property in Salisbury, MD, regular upkeep can help sustain effective water flow and prevent pooling over time. Costs depend on the frequency and extent of services needed.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water pooling around a property? Water pooling can result from poor drainage, uneven terrain, clogged gutters, or inadequate slope grading around the landscape.

How can water pooling damage a property? Standing water can lead to foundation issues, erosion, mold growth, and damage to landscaping or structures over time.

What services are available to prevent water pooling? Local contractors offer drainage solutions, grading services, gutter maintenance, and installation of drainage systems to prevent pooling.

How do I know if my property needs water pooling prevention? Signs include persistent puddles after rain, soggy areas, or water accumulating near foundations or walkways.

What steps are involved in fixing water pooling problems? Professionals assess the site, recommend appropriate drainage solutions, and implement grading, drainage systems, or gutter improvements.
